Highest Education Level

Dental Assistants in Montana offer the following education background
Vocational Degree or Certification
29.3%
High School or GED
23.9%
Bachelor's Degree
19.0%
Associate's Degree
16.5%
Doctorate Degree
4.6%
Some College
3.0%
Master's Degree
2.6%
Some High School
1.1%
